Petra Corner Hotel is perhaps the embodiment of Arab hospitality in Petra. We hadn't planned on staying a night in Petra, because there is generally not much to do in Wadi Musa if you don't have a car. However, we met another guest at the Hotel at the treasury and he recommended the place to us (himself being a very experienced hotelier). So we stayed and did not regret that we had done so. The staff was very friendly and tried to cater to any wish we had. The rooms were extremely clean and seemed to be newly renovated. The breakfast was delicious and we were allowed to stay some hours longer without any extra cost to pack up our things. If we ever come to Petra again, we will definitely stay here. We also asked for a lunch recommendation and the concierge referred us to an amazing local restaurant with great prices and even greater food.…

Hotel is new and the staff is excellent. Very helpful and service minded reception staff. They have just started their buffet style dinner which is a good-value for-money option. Staff in the dinner / breakfast room provide serve with a genuine smile. Rooms are bright and clean and the hotel is very close to the Petra visiting centre (5-10 min. walk).
